SAINT BONNET DE ROCHEFORT 03800

Usine avec stockage proche de Vichy Gannat avec accés à l'autoroute (03)

  • area
    4500 m2

Presentation of the property : Shop 1 room for sale in SAINT BONNET DE ROCHEFORT

Opportunité rare sur le marché dans une zone pharmaceutique, nutrition, santé.



Bâtiment composé d’un hall d’accueil avec 2 bureaux puis 5 bureaux direction et personnel administratif, toilettes clients et pièce informatique (baie de brassage).

2 espaces de production avec atelier de maintenance, locaux techniques intérieur et extérieur.

Espaces stockage d’une capacité de 1350 palettes avec zone de départ puis 2 quais de réception poids lourds.

Surface totale d’environ 4500 M² couvert.

Accès autoroute à environ un quart d’heure du site.



Ces caractéristiques font de cette emplacement un choix idéal pour les entreprises cherchant à s’installer dans une zone bien équipée.

Investing in commercial properties can offer several attractive advantages for investors. Here are some reasons why this type of investment can be appealing:

High returns
Tenant stability: Businesses tend to sign long-term leases (often between 3 and 9 years). This provides stable rental income over the long term and reduces the risk of vacancy.
Property appreciation: Commercial properties can increase in value over time, especially if they are located in developing areas or thriving business districts.
Diversification opportunities: Investing in commercial properties allows for the diversification of an investment portfolio. This helps reduce risks by spreading investments across different types of real estate assets (offices, retail spaces, warehouses, etc.).
Less daily management: Compared to managing residential properties, commercial properties require less daily management. Tenant businesses are generally responsible for routine maintenance.
